The Core Mechanics: How Siding is Measured

Before we dive into the tools, you must understand the unit of measure. Vinyl siding is not sold by the individual panel in the same way lumber is sold by the board foot. It is sold in units known as “squares.”

What is a “Square” in Siding?

A “square” is a unit of area covering 100 square feet. This is the industry standard. When a siding square footage calculator provides a result, you will almost always convert that number into “squares” for ordering.

The Formula:
Total Square Footage / 100 = Number of Squares Required

However, this is the net area. Vinyl siding overlaps both horizontally and vertically to allow for thermal expansion and contraction. Therefore, the gross coverage of a panel is slightly less than its physical dimensions.

Net Coverage vs. Gross Coverage

This is the most common pitfall for DIYers. A vinyl plank might physically measure 10 feet long and 10 inches high, but the “exposed face” (the part that remains visible after installation) might only be 9 inches. This exposure gap is accounted for in the manufacturer’s specifications, which is why a siding measurement calculator must factor in the specific overlap ratios.


Mastering the Variables: Beyond the Rectangle

A flat, windowless wall is rare. Most homes feature complex geometries. A robust wall siding calculator distinguishes between simple rectangles, triangles, and trapezoids.

1. Rectangular Walls (Gable Ends Excluded)

This is the baseline. Measure the width and height, multiply them, and subtract the area of windows and doors.

  • Formula: (Width × Height) – (Window Area + Door Area)

2. Gables and Triangular Areas

Gables are triangles. The formula here is (Base Width × Height) / 2. However, a siding square calculator often applies a waste factor automatically to gables because the angled cuts create more off-fall than vertical walls.

3. Dormers and Bay Windows

These add significant complexity. Dormers combine small rectangles and triangles. Bay windows often feature angled walls that require trapezoid calculations. Using a siding panels calculator designed for architectural features prevents severe under-buying.

4. The Waste Factor

You cannot cover a 10-foot wall with a 10-foot piece of siding and expect perfect alignment with the starter strip and trim. You will have cut-offs. Industry standards suggest adding:

  • 5% to 10% for simple ranch styles (minimal cutting).

  • 10% to 15% for Colonials or Cape Cods (gables, dormers, multiple windows).

  • 15% to 20% for custom architecture.

A quality siding estimator will ask about the complexity of your roof lines to adjust this factor dynamically.


The Ultimate Step-by-Step: Using a Vinyl Siding Calculator

Let’s walk through a hypothetical project to demonstrate the power of a siding measurement tool. We will calculate for a standard two-story home with four corners and a moderate roof pitch.

Step 1: Measure the Perimeter
Walk the foundation and measure the linear feet of every exterior wall. Do this at ground level; it is the safest and most accurate method.

Step 2: Measure the Height
Measure from the top of the foundation sill plate to the underside of the soffit. Do this at the corner of the house where the ground is level.

Step 3: Calculate Gross Wall Area
Multiply the total perimeter by the average wall height.

  • Example: 150 linear ft of wall × 9 ft height = 1,350 sq ft.

Step 4: Subtract Openings
Measure the height and width of every window and door. Multiply them to get the square footage of each, sum them, and subtract from the gross wall area.

  • Example: Total openings = 220 sq ft.

  • Net Wall Area: 1,350 – 220 = 1,130 sq ft.

Step 5: Add Gables
Measure the base and height of each gable. Calculate the triangle area and add it to the wall area.

  • Example: Two gables at 120 sq ft each = 240 sq ft.

  • Total Area (Pre-Waste): 1,130 + 240 = 1,370 sq ft.

Step 6: Apply Waste Factor
Multiply total area by 1.10 (for 10% waste).

  • Order Area: 1,370 × 1.10 = 1,507 sq ft.

Step 7: Convert to Squares
Divide by 100.

  • Squares Required: 15.07 squares. (You would round up to 15.25 or 15.5 depending on supplier policy).

Advanced Estimation: Panels, Trim, and Accessories

While the vinyl siding quantity estimator focuses on the cladding itself, a complete siding renovation calculator must account for the supporting cast. Many homeowners forget that siding is a system, not just a skin.

Calculating Starter Strips

Starter strips run the entire perimeter of the house. You need the same linear footage as the base of your walls.

J-Channel Estimation

J-Channel is used around windows, doors, and where the siding meets the gable trim. A standard window requires J-Channel equal to its perimeter plus a small allowance for mitered corners. A siding installation calculator will usually request the number of windows and doors to estimate this automatically.

Inside and Outside Corners

Corner posts are sold by the linear foot. Measure the height of every corner from the starter strip to the frieze board. Sum these heights. If you have 10-foot corners, you will cut waste, so always round up to the nearest available length (usually 10ft or 12.5ft).

Soffit and Fascia

Often, a house exterior calculator is used concurrently with siding estimation. Soffit is measured in square footage (like siding), while fascia is measured in linear feet.


Cost Considerations: From Square Footage to Budget

While material costs fluctuate regionally and by brand, the siding cost calculator function of a good estimator helps you compare apples to apples. The price of vinyl siding is generally quoted per square.

Factors influencing cost:

  1. Profile: Dutch lap, beaded, clapboard, and shake profiles have different material densities and price points.

  2. Thickness: .040 gauge is standard; .044 or .048 gauge is premium, offering better impact resistance.

  3. Insulation: Insulated vinyl siding costs more per square foot but reduces the need for separate house wrap and offers higher R-value.

Common Calculation Errors and How to Avoid Them

Even with a digital siding calculator for house, garbage in equals garbage out. Here are the most frequent measurement mistakes:

1. Measuring Over Old Siding
If you are measuring for a tear-off, you are likely measuring over existing aluminum or wood siding. This adds several inches to the depth of corners and the overall footprint of the house. For the most accurate siding replacement calculator, you need the sheathing dimensions, not the exterior cladding dimensions.

2. Forgetting the “Z-Factor” in Corners
When measuring corner posts, you need the height from the starter strip to the soffit, plus a small insertion allowance at the top and bottom. Failing to add this 1-2 inches results in corner posts that are too short.

3. Ignoring the Water Table
The water table is the transition piece at the bottom of the wall where it meets the foundation. This area sometimes requires special accessory pieces. A basic siding squares calculator might miss this nuance, but a comprehensive siding project estimator will prompt you for foundation details.

Data-Backed Insights: The Cost of Inaccuracy

Industry data suggests that material overage on residential siding projects averages 12% to 18% for DIYers, compared to 8% to 12% for professionals. This delta represents pure profit leakage. By using a vinyl siding coverage estimator, DIYers can immediately close this gap.

Furthermore, under-ordering is more expensive than over-ordering. A second, small order for “fill-in” material often incurs shipping fees, special handling charges, and the risk of dye-lot variation (where the color of the new batch does not perfectly match the original batch). Accurate initial measurement eliminates this risk.

3. What is the difference between a siding square and a square foot?
A square is a unit of measure equal to 100 square feet. It is the standard unit for ordering and quoting vinyl siding.

4. How much siding do I need for a 2,000 sq ft house?
The wall area is usually less than the floor area. A rough estimate is 1,500 to 1,800 sq ft of wall space (15 to 18 squares), but you must subtract windows and add gables.

5. Can I calculate siding for a barn or shed using these tools?
Yes. A wall siding calculator works on any vertical surface, regardless of whether it is a residence or an outbuilding.

6. How do I measure for siding on a curved wall?
Curved walls require flexible vinyl or custom bending. Measure the arc length and the height, treating it as a rectangle. Expect higher waste (20%+).

7. What is the waste factor for gables?
Gables typically require a 15% waste factor due to the angled cuts and the inability to use short remnants efficiently.

8. Should I include the chimney area in my siding measurement?
No. Subtract the chimney area. You will flash around it, not side over it.

9. How do I calculate J-channel for windows?
Measure the perimeter of the window in inches, divide by 12 to get linear feet, and add 10% for miter cuts and scrap.
